When connected to USB, the device is recognized as [unknown USB device].

 

*Operation Verification

Verified with PC and USB only, without JTAG terminal connected

 

1)Win11pro desktop : Ver23H2 : Not recognized both by USB direct

connection and self-power HUB

2) Win11pro Laptop: Ver23H2: Not recognized both by direct USB connection

and via self-powered HUB.

3) Win10pro laptop: Ver22H2: Both USB direct connection and via

self-powered HUB are not recognized.

Intel Products Used Quartus Prime 23.1std

All Unknown USB device (device descriptor request failed) code 43

Hi Venu,


Kindly try below:


  1. Ensure that USB Blaster Adapter connected to the board in correct manner(one to one mapping)
  2. Complete reinstall of Quartus Prime
  3. Running as admin


Another try:


  1. Disconnect other USB device
  2. uninstall and reinstall the usb blaster driver
  3. You can also try this https://www.intel.com/content/www/us/en/support/programmable/articles/000073673.html
  4. If you have another USB Blaster, please try using another one and see if it works.
